- After-Hours Access: Did you know that you can access the Information Commons even when it's officially closed? With your Loyola ID, you can swipe in and continue studying late into the night. This is a lifesaver during those all-nighters! The Information Commons offers after-hours access to Loyola students, allowing them to study and work on projects even when the library is officially closed. With your Loyola ID, you can swipe in and continue studying late into the night. This is a valuable resource for students who prefer to study at night or who need to complete last-minute assignments. The after-hours access area is typically located on the first floor of the Information Commons and includes study spaces, computers, and printing facilities. The area is monitored by security cameras to ensure student safety. To access the Information Commons after hours, simply swipe your Loyola ID at the entrance. Make sure to have your ID with you at all times, as you may be asked to show it to security personnel. Unveiling the Loyola Chicago Information Commons
So, what exactly is the Loyola Chicago Information Commons? Well, it's not just your average library – it's a state-of-the-art learning and research hub designed to support students, faculty, and staff at Loyola University Chicago. Think of it as the academic heart of the campus, a place where technology, information, and collaboration come together to foster intellectual growth. The Information Commons provides a dynamic and innovative environment, offering a wide range of services and resources tailored to meet the diverse needs of the Loyola community. It's more than just books; it's a place where you can access cutting-edge technology, collaborate with classmates, receive expert research assistance, and find a quiet corner to focus on your studies.
